Type of Fee (Note 1) Amount Due Date
Royalty (Notes 2 and 3) Greater of 8% of Gross Sales or Minimum Monthly Royalty Fee Requirement Monthly as designated by us Will be debited automatically from your bank account by ACH or other means designated by us. See, Notes 2 and 3 for Minimum Monthly Royalty Requirements.
Brand Development Fund (Note 4) 2% of Gross Sales for annual Gross Sales up to $500,000 and 1% of Gross Sales for annual Gross Sales over $500,000, but not exceeding $20,000 per year Monthly as designated by us Will be debited automatically from your bank account by ACH or other means designated by us.
Franchisee Directed Local Marketing (Note 5) 3% of monthly Gross Sales, but not less than $500 per Territory per month Monthly as incurred by you Must be spent by you monthly on pre- approved marketing within your operating territory. Subject to Minimum Monthly Local Marketing Requirements depending on the size of your operating territory.
Advertising Cooperatives (Note 6) Up to 3% of monthly Gross Sales but not exceeding the local marketing requirement, currently not assessed As established by cooperative members If we authorize an Advertising Cooperative, fees that you pay to the cooperative will count to the satisfaction of your local marketing requirements but will not exceed the local marketing requirement.

Business Management System (Note 8) Currently $189 per month plus $90 per user per month Monthly as designated by us Will be debited automatically from your bank account by ACH or other means designated by us. We may increase the Business Management System fee if the designated vendors increase the license fees.
QuickBooks Software Currently $35 to $50 per month When invoiced You must pay an ongoing monthly license fee to our designated accounting software vendor, currently QuickBooks. This fee may increase if the designated vendor increases the license fees.
Mailchimp Software Currently up to $680 per month When invoiced You must pay an ongoing monthly fee to for access to Mailchimp. This fee may increase if the designated vendor increases the license fees.

Annual Conference (Note 10) Our then current conference fee, not greater than $1,000 per attendee, currently $500 per attendee When invoiced Required attendance fee for an annual System conference. You will be responsible for all travel and lodging expenses.
Strategic Leadership Council Not greater than $150 per year, currently not assessed Monthly as designated by us Will be debited automatically from your bank account by ACH or other means designated by us. The strategic leadership council fee is an annual fee collected by us and offsets our costs related to holding regular meetings with our franchisee advisory strategic leadership council.

Source: Item 6 — OTHER FEES (FDD pages 12–16)

According to Bee Organized's 2025 Franchise Disclosure Document, the Strategic Leadership Council fee is an annual fee collected by Bee Organized to offset costs related to holding regular meetings with their franchisee advisory strategic leadership council. This fee is currently not assessed, but the FDD states it will not be greater than $150 per year.

This fee, if assessed, would be debited automatically from the franchisee's bank account. The Strategic Leadership Council provides a formal channel for franchisees to provide feedback and insights to Bee Organized leadership. This type of council is common in franchising, as it helps franchisors stay informed about the needs and concerns of their franchisees, and allows franchisees to have a voice in the direction of the brand.
